F09
Bauknecht
Software Configuration / EEPROM Parameter Error
Dryer displays F09 and may not start or may stop unexpectedly.

Possible Causes
Corrupted program data in control board, Incorrect configuration after board replacement, Power surge during operation, Defective main control board
How to Fix / Troubleshooting
Safety first: Disconnect the dryer from mains power before removing covers.
- Power reset: Unplug the dryer for at least 10 minutes to allow the control to fully discharge, then reconnect and test.
- Check model configuration: If the main control board was recently replaced, ensure it is correctly configured for your specific Bauknecht dryer model (this often requires service software or technician access).
- Inspect control board: Remove the top cover and visually inspect the PCB for burnt components or moisture damage.
- Surge protection: If F09 appeared after a storm or power event, consider using a surge protector after repair to prevent recurrence.
- If F09 persists: The control board likely needs reprogramming or replacement, which is typically a technician-level task.
Warning: Do not attempt to reflash or modify firmware without proper tools and files; this can permanently damage the appliance.
